Which is the best estimate for the average rate of change for the quadratic function graph on the interval 0 ≤ x ≤ 4?
den301095 [7]
ANSWER

A) -1

EXPLANATION

The average rate of change of the given quadratic function on the interval 0 ≤ x ≤4 is the slope of the secant line connecting the points (0,f(0)) and (4,f(4)).

That is the average rate of change is:

= \frac{f(4) - f(0)}{4 - 0}

From the graph, f(0) is 0 and f(4) is -4.

We plug in these values to obtain;

= \frac{ - 4 - 0}{4 - 0}

This simplifies to;

= \frac{ - 4}{4}

= - 1

Hence the average rate of change for the given quadratic function whose graph is shown on 0≤x≤4 is -1
